[0028] See attached figure 1 As shown, it is a schematic diagram of the axial cross-sectional structure of the stator of the moving coil type permanent magnet linear rotating motor of the present invention. The stator of the moving coil type permanent magnet linear rotating motor includes a sleeve-shaped outer stator core yoke 1, wherein a port of the outer stator core yoke 1 is positioned and provided with a magnetic field capable of generating linear motion.
